St. John's Postgame Notes
11/22/2008 12:00:00 AM | Men's Basketball
Nov. 22, 2008
QUEENS, N.Y. -
- St. John's scored at least 70 points for the fourth time in four games this year.
- The 44 points scored by Howard were the fewest allowed by the Red Storm since Dec. 20, 2006 when St. John's defeated BU, 45-44, in overtime.
- St. John's scored 42 points in the first half, the most points scored in the opening frame since tallying 42 against FDU on Nov. 25, 2007.
- The Red Storm made a season-high seven 3-pointers and shot a season-high 46.7 percent from beyond the arc.
- St. John's committed a season-low seven turnovers.
- The Red Storm's 17 offensive rebounds were a season high and the squad is 3-0 when outrebounding the opposition.
- D.J. Kennedy scored in double figures for the third time this season and added his third-career double-double.
- In his first career start, Paris Horne played a career-high 35 minutes and set a new career-high with 15 points.
- Tomas Jasiulionis made his first appearance of the season and added five points and four rebounds.
- Phil Wait grabbed a career-high two rebounds and also added his first career assist and block.
- Rob Thomas tied a career-high with eight points and set a new career-high with eight rebounds, including six offensive boards.
- St. John's scored 21 second-half points and also converted 17 Howard turnovers into 16 points.
- The Red Storm outscored Howard, 40-20, in the paint.
- After winning the tip, St. John's jumped out to a 19-3 run in the first half.
- St. John's had a season-high six blocks and added seven steals.
- The Red Storm held Howard to just 33.3 percent shooting, including 26.7 percent from long range.
